2 Paralipomenon 28:1-4 Douay-Rheims Challoner Revision 1752 (DRC1752)

1. Achaz was twenty years old when he began to reign, and he reigned sixteen years in Jerusalem: he did not that which was right in the sight of the Lord as David his father had done,

2. But walked in the ways of the kings of Israel; moreover also he cast statues for Baalim.

3. It was he that burnt incense in the valley of Benennom, and consecrated his sons in the fire according to the manner of the nations, which the Lord slew at the coming of the children of Israel.

4. He sacrificed also, and burnt incense in the high places, and on the hills, and under every green tree.
